Solution Overview
Problem
Conventional resistance welding systems face challenges in maintaining consistent quality of weld spots, especially with new material thickness combinations, due to limitations in force regulation and path signal detection, which affects the process window and weldability.
Innovation Solution
A device and method for position control of pliers-shaped tools that compensates for mechanical bending and force variations by generating a standardized path signal, allowing for targeted force regulation and improved monitoring of the welding process, enabling consistent quality across different material combinations and tool configurations.

AI summary
A control device (10) for a welding tool (21) and a method for position control of a welding tool (21; 210; 2100) are provided. The control device (10) has a determination module (11) for determining a normalized displacement signal (Sn(t)) in which a bending of the pincer-shaped tool (21; 210; 2100) is compensated, which is generated by the action of a mechanical force (Fs(t)) on the tool (21; 210; 2100) during a work operation (S2, S3, S4; S5; S8; S13; S17; S20) with the pincer-shaped tool (21; 210; 2100), and a force control module (12) for controlling a curve of the force (Fs(t)) which the pincer-shaped tool (21; 210; 2100) exerts on at least one component (5, 6) during the work operation (S2, S3, S4; S5; S8; S13; S17; S20). exerts, wherein the force control module (12) is designed to control the course of the force (Fs(t)) during the work process (S8; S13; S17; S20) using the normalized displacement signal (Sn(t)).
